    Aitken played the 90 as Airdrie beat Dundee 1-0. O'Connor came on after 53 minutes.

    Murray Johnston kept a clean sheet in a 2-0 win for Qots away to Elgin which also saw Kyle McClelland sent off on 71mins for two yellow cards in 5 minutes .

    Dylan Tait played 68 minutes in a 1-1 draw for Hamilton away to premier League Livingston.

    Good to see the guys out on loan getting some minutes and experience.
